Should Flags Be Flown At Full-Mast At Trump’s Inauguration?

As Donald Trump prepares for his second inauguration, the nation faces a unique situation. On the same day, flags are expected to be flown at half-mast in honor of the passing of former President Jimmy Carter. This marks a moment of national mourning, as the country pays tribute to the life and legacy of the 39th president. With that in mind, should flags still be flown at full-mast to celebrate Trump’s second inauguration, or would it be more appropriate to follow the tradition of respect and keep them at half-mast in remembrance of Carter’s death?
